1. What is a Cubic mm to Litres Calculator?

Definition: This calculator converts volume measurements from cubic millimeters (mm³) to litres (L).

Purpose: It helps in converting small volume measurements commonly used in engineering and scientific calculations to more practical litre measurements.

2. How Does the Calculator Work?

The calculator uses the formula:

\[ V_L = \frac{V}{1,000,000} \]

Where:

Explanation: There are 1,000,000 cubic millimeters in one litre, so we divide the mm³ value by 1,000,000 to get litres.

5.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q1: Why convert mm³ to litres?
A: While mm³ are useful for small, precise measurements, litres are more practical for real-world applications and larger quantities.

Q2: How many mm³ are in a litre?
A: There are exactly 1,000,000 mm³ in one litre.

Q3: What's the relationship to cubic centimeters?
A: 1 cm³ = 1,000 mm³, and 1,000 cm³ = 1 litre, which is why the conversion factor is 1,000,000.

Q4: When would I need this conversion?
A: Common in engineering drawings (mm³) to real-world liquid measurements (litres), or when working with small fluid volumes in lab settings.

Q5: How precise is this conversion?
A: The conversion is mathematically exact, though practical measurements may have precision limitations.
